Training Manager Job Description

The Training Manager assists in the development, coordination, and delivery of new hire orientation for R/BTs, BCBAs, and Licensed Psychologists, ensuring a supportive and comprehensive onboarding experience across all staff levels. The Training Manager must effectively coordinate and collaborate cross-functionally to ensure new hires have any necessary training from other Frontera departments (e.g., people operations, product, engineering, clinical operations, payor operations, etc.). 

This position fully owns FronteraCare's Behavior Technician (BT) and Registered Behavior Technician (RBT) training functions across all regions. This role directly supervises the Training Support Specialist and is expected to personally execute every part of that position – new hire orientation, module tracking, coaching, and onboarding logistics. Beyond day-to-day training delivery, the Training Manager builds and maintains the training curriculum, schedules and audits training quality across all locations, owns training data and reporting, and drives automation and process improvement across the training pipeline. This position reports to the Head of Clinical Training.

Key Responsibilities

Training Leadership & Team Oversight

  • Supervises the Training Support Specialist(s), providing day-to-day direction, coaching, and support. This role will personally step in and execute the Training Support Specialist role during gaps, surges, or as needed.
  • Leads Behavior Technician training directly including leading training, presenting in orientation, and running clinical competencies on new hires.
  • Serves as the escalation point whenever a new hire's progress or conduct raises concern.

Training Development, Curriculum & Quality

  • Develops and updates BT/RBT training content, orientation materials, and supporting job aids to keep them current and effective.
  • Audits existing trainings on a recurring basis to confirm they meet quality standards, reflect current practice, and produce the intended competencies.
  • Identifies opportunities to automate or streamline training workflows and partners with the Head of Clinical Training to implement improvements.
  • Schedule and deliver BCBA-level training and collaborate with the Head of Clinical Training on other BCBA training opportunities. 

Training Data & Reporting

  • Owns new hire and ongoing training data – completion status, timelines, and competency tracking – and keeps it organized, accurate, and easy to review.
  • Regularly reviews training data to identify trends, bottlenecks, or regions falling behind, and takes action to correct course.
  • Reports on training progress and quality metrics to the Head of Clinical Training.

Multi-Location Quality & Travel

  • Ensures training quality is consistent across all FronteraCare locations.
  • Travels on an approximately 90-day cadence to directly implement and reinforce training on-site at clinics outside the home region.
  • Coordinates with RBT Leads and BCBA Regional Leads at each location to confirm training practices in the field match FronteraCare standards.

Qualifications

  •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A) certification required, with at least 5 years certified as a BCBA.
  • Prior experience successfully leading and designing BT training and BCBA training.
  • Strong instructional design, facilitation, and presentation skills, with the ability to build and revise training content from the ground up.
  • Demonstrated ability to build effective working relationships across roles and levels, and to communicate clearly with diverse audiences (new hires through senior clinical staff).
  • Track record of adapting quickly to shifting priorities and taking on new or undefined tasks as organizational needs change.
  • Comfortable working hands-on – this role executes training tasks directly, not just manages them.
  • Strong organizational skills and attention to detail, with the ability to manage multiple open projects and priorities at once while maintaining accuracy in materials, scheduling, and documentation.
  • Able to travel regionally on a recurring (approximately every 90 days) basis.
  • Proficiency with learning management systems and Google Workspace tools (Meet, Sheets, Calendar, etc.).
  • Leadership experience working across remote/hybrid with multi-location teams.
  • Located in AZ, CO, ID, FL, GA, NC, NM, NV, TX, or UT.
